Two rival dry cleaners both advertise their prices. Let x equal the number of items dry cleaned. Store A's prices are represente

d by the expression 15x - 2. Store B's prices are represented by the expression 3(5x + 7). When do the two stores charge the same rate?

Store A's prices are represented by the expression 15x - 2.

Store B's prices are represented by the expression 3(5x + 7).

To find when the 2 stores charge the same rate , we set the expression equal and solve for x

15x - 2 = 3(5x+7)

15x -2 = 15x + 21

Subtract 15x on both sides

-2 = 21

We cannot solve for x

So , the price of two stores never be same

Two stores never charge the same rate

Question Complete: Carlo wants to join the gym. The gym offers three membership options

1.Pay as you go = Pay only $6 each time you work out

2.Regular deal = Pay $50 a month and $2 each time you work out

2.All in one price = Pay one time $100 per month for unlimited use of our great facilities.

Carlo thinks he will go to the gym about 20 times a month.

Calculate how much each of these options would cost Carlo for one month.

Solution:

Option 1. Pay as you go:

Each time gym fee = $6

Carlo thinks he will go to gym 20 times a month

So,

Cost for option 1 = $6 x 20 = $120

Option 2. Regular deal:

$50 a month + $2 each time

So, Carlo thinks he will go to gym 20 times a month

Cost for option 2 = $50 + 20x(2$) = $90

Similarly,

Option 3. All in one price:  

Fee = one time $100 per month.

Cost for option 3 = $100 per month

Because there is not any each time visit fee in this option, so whether Carlo go to gym 20 times or 30 times a day. he will be charged a fixed fee of $100 a month.

For Carlo, regular deal is the best option to choose because he goes to gym 20 times and it is least expensive.
